Transaction 2ebb85f1dbfff2c71c8ee838ee96c99fd1696d33fba149863e088447fdd73cc9
1 Input
1 Output
-
2ebb85f1dbfff2c71c8ee838ee96c99fd1696d33fba149863e088447fdd73cc9:0
- value
- 14711744
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 573b86d6b200b2fcf328b4702ec7c5a8d3d04d0a OP_EQUAL
- address
- 39eG2Dob95yM4ez2AkLCzi73gJCpxcw8mE